Batesville Memorial Pool Rules 

  1. Running is not allowed.  Please walk at all times.
  2. Sitting or standing on shoulders of others is not allowed.
  3. Jumping or diving over other patrons (in the game, “Wall”, for example) is not allowed.
  4. No shoes are to be worn on the pool deck.
  5. Swim suits must be worn.  No cut off jeans or shorts of any sort are to be worn in the pool.
  6. Tobacco products of any sort are not permitted within the pool gates, including vapes, E-cigarettes, vapor pens, chewing tobacco, etc.  Please use the designated smoking area located outside to the left when exiting the building out the front door.
  7. No diving is allowed in the 3’ and 4’ areas of the pool.  Jumping or diving from the red line area in the deep end of the pool is not allowed.  Jumping or diving is only allowed from the green line.
  8. You must be able to swim the width of the swimming pool to swim in the deep end to use the diving board.  See lifeguard for swim test.
  9. Lifejackets or any flotation devices are not permitted on the diving board.
  10. One bounce is allowed on the diving board.
  11. Only one person is allowed on the diving board at a time.  Next person must stand on concrete deck until the dive/jump is completed by the previous user.  Waiting until that user reaches the ladder to exit the pool is required before the next jumper/diver enter the pool.
  12. You must jump straight out from the diving boards, rather than towards the side wall.No goggles are allowed in the dive pool.
  13. Pool provided life jackets are for slide use only.  Please do not remove them from the area.
  14. If a slider uses a life jacket, a responsible adult or babysitter must be present at the dive/slide pool.
  15. One rider on the slide is allowed at a time.  Arms and feet must be crossed when traveling down the slide.  Rider must ride feet first the entire ride.
  16. Goggles are not permitted to be worn in the dive/slide pool.
  17. Inflatable toys, life jackets, noodles, etc. are permitted only in the shallow end of the pool.
  18. Floats can be no larger than six feet in length.  Pool staff reserves the right to regulate the use of floats and toys if pool is crowded or misuse occurs.
  19. No glass of any kind is permitted at the pool, decks, splash pad, patio, locker rooms, etc.
  20. Children under the age of 8 must be accompanied by a responsible adult or babysitter at all times when on pool property.
  21. Foul language or personal display of affection is not permitted on pool property.
  22. No consumption of alcohol is permitted on pool grounds.

These rules help maintain a safe and sanitary pool for your use and enjoyment.  Those people who cannot obey these rules will be asked to leave pool property.
